#7a0df3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7a0df3 is composed of 47.8% red, 5.1% green and 95.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.8% cyan, 94.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 268.4 degrees, a saturation of 90.6% and a lightness of 50.2%. #7a0df3 color hex could be obtained by blending #f41aff with #0000e7. Closest websafe color is: #6600ff.

#7a0df3 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7a0df3 has RGB values of R:122, G:13, B:243 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 7998963.

Hex triplet 7a0df3 #7a0df3
RGB Decimal 122, 13, 243 rgb(122,13,243)
RGB Percent 47.8, 5.1, 95.3 rgb(47.8%,5.1%,95.3%)
CMYK 50, 95, 0, 5
HSL 268.4°, 90.6, 50.2 hsl(268.4,90.6%,50.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 268.4°, 94.7, 95.3
Web Safe 6600ff #6600ff
CIE-LAB 39.405, 78.72, -89.068
XYZ 24.345, 10.896, 85.61
xyY 0.201, 0.09, 10.896
CIE-LCH 39.405, 118.87, 311.471
CIE-LUV 39.405, 10.849, -126.926
Hunter-Lab 33.009, 73.879, -130.661
Binary 01111010, 00001101, 11110011

Shades and Tints of #7a0df3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f5edf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#7a0df3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#807888 is the less saturated color, while #7903fd is the most saturated one.
